People love to talk about the Sunday scaries — the anxious feeling you get when the weight of the upcoming week overwhelms you —but Glass House is turning that phrase on its spooky head with a not-so-scary-but-still-creepy Halloween brunch. On Sunday, October 28th, bring your squad (or the fam) for chef Ben Hennemuth’s themed menu items like the monster hash and boo-berry pancakes, plus crafts and whimsical cocktails between 11:00am and 3:00pm. Costumes are encouraged and all ages are welcome. See menu details for the haunted happening here, and call 617.945.9450 to book your spot.
